In the world of fasteners, the importance of each component cannot be overstated. Among these components, the single threaded screw plays a crucial role in various applications, from construction to everyday household items. Understanding what a single threaded screw is and how it functions can greatly enhance our knowledge of mechanical assemblies and their reliability.A single threaded screw is characterized by having a single helical ridge that wraps around its shaft. This design allows for efficient fastening and provides a strong grip when driven into materials such as wood, metal, or plastic. The simplicity of the single threaded screw makes it one of the most commonly used screws in the industry. Unlike double-threaded screws, which have two helical ridges, the single-threaded variant offers unique advantages, particularly in terms of ease of use and manufacturing.One of the primary benefits of using a single threaded screw is its straightforward installation process. Due to its single thread, it requires less torque to drive into the material, making it easier for individuals, even those with minimal experience, to use. This aspect is especially important in DIY projects where the user may not have access to specialized tools. Furthermore, the single threaded screw is often more forgiving in terms of alignment; if slightly misaligned during installation, it can still secure the materials effectively without stripping the threads.From a mechanical perspective, the design of a single threaded screw allows for effective load distribution. When properly installed, the screw can bear significant weight and resist pulling forces. This feature is particularly valuable in construction, where structural integrity is paramount. Builders often rely on single threaded screws to hold together framing, cabinetry, and other essential components of a structure. The reliability of these screws contributes to the overall safety and durability of buildings.Moreover, the versatility of the single threaded screw extends beyond just construction. These screws are widely used in furniture assembly, automotive applications, and electronic devices. For instance, many pieces of flat-pack furniture are designed with single threaded screws to allow consumers to easily assemble their products at home. Similarly, in the automotive industry, these screws are utilized in various components, ensuring that parts remain securely fastened under dynamic conditions.Despite its many advantages, it is essential to understand the limitations of a single threaded screw. While they are excellent for joining materials together, they may not provide the same level of holding power as other fasteners, such as bolts or anchors, in certain situations. For heavy-duty applications, engineers might opt for multi-threaded screws or other types of fasteners that offer enhanced strength and stability.In conclusion, the single threaded screw is an indispensable component in the realm of fasteners. Its unique design, ease of use, and versatility make it a preferred choice for many applications. Whether you are a professional builder or a DIY enthusiast, understanding the functionality and benefits of the single threaded screw can empower you to make informed decisions when selecting fasteners for your projects. As we continue to innovate and improve in various fields, the humble single threaded screw remains a testament to the ingenuity of simple yet effective design.
